## Sensor drift: what to do at 3am

If the GrowLoop controller starts reporting humidity swings that don't match the backup probes in the Fernwick greenhouse, it's almost always sensor drift, not an actual climate event. Don't panic and don't touch the vents manually. First, restart the calibration daemon and give it ten minutes to re-baseline. If readings still disagree by more than 5%, flip the controller into safe mode. The safe-mode thresholds it will use are these.

config for yahap-bajof:
[istix]
host = istix.qorvelsys.internal
user = istix_svc
database = istix_prod

Environments: Rowhouse Seat-Map Renderer

Rowhouse renders seat maps for the Pellingford Theatre booking flow. Three environments: dev, staging, prod. Dev uses synthetic venue layouts. Staging pulls a weekly snapshot of the real auditorium plan. Prod serves live availability. Release cadence: fortnightly, staging soak of 48 hours minimum. Canvas fallback is enabled everywhere except dev. Do not promote builds that change the tier colour palette without box-office sign-off. Current per-environment values are below.

settings of yageg-yahap:
[gorael]
team = olieth
access_code = ac_941d74
owner = brieth.aldiel
host = gorael.tolvaqio.internal
port = 6379
peer = briwyn.urlaqtech.internal
salt = 116e6622
pin = 1957

Since you're managing releases for our elevator-dispatch simulator, here's the short version: Liftwise replays real building traffic patterns against candidate dispatch algorithms, so every release needs a fresh scenario pack baked in. Don't ship without rerunning the Towerline benchmark suite — it catches regressions in peak-morning handling that unit tests miss. Release cuts happen Tuesdays; the sim team freezes scenarios Monday noon. Everything you need, including the cut checklist and benchmark history, lives on the internal release page.

dashboard of yahaf-kajep = https://jira.zemvarsys.internal/display/projects/browse/browse/a08b